1. Understanding the Importance of English Proficiency in Hong Kong
Hong Kong is a unique blend of Eastern and Western cultures, and English serves as one of the official languages alongside Chinese. The city’s international business environment necessitates a high level of English proficiency, particularly in sectors such as finance, law, and education. According to a report by the British Council, over 60% of employers in Hong Kong consider English proficiency a critical factor when hiring. This statistic underscores the importance of mastering the language to enhance career prospects and professional growth.
2. Effective Strategies for Improving English Skills
Improving your English proficiency requires a strategic approach. Here are some effective strategies to consider:
- Engage in Immersive Learning: Surround yourself with English through media, books, and conversations. Watching English films or listening to podcasts can significantly enhance your listening skills and vocabulary.
- Practice Speaking Regularly: Join language exchange groups or conversation clubs in Hong Kong. Engaging with native speakers will boost your confidence and fluency.
- Utilise Online Resources: Leverage platforms like Duolingo, Babbel, or even YouTube channels dedicated to English learning. These resources offer interactive and engaging ways to improve your skills.
- Take Formal Classes: Enrolling in English language courses, such as those offered by the British Council or local universities, can provide structured learning and professional guidance.
3. The Role of Technology in Language Learning
In the digital age, technology plays a pivotal role in language acquisition. Various apps and online platforms have revolutionised the way we learn languages. For instance, tools like Grammarly can help improve writing skills by providing real-time feedback on grammar and style. Additionally, virtual reality (VR) language learning programs are emerging, offering immersive experiences that simulate real-life conversations.
Moreover, social media platforms can be utilised to connect with English speakers worldwide. Engaging in discussions on platforms like Twitter or LinkedIn can enhance your writing skills and expand your professional network.
4. Cultural Nuances and Their Impact on Language Mastery
Understanding cultural nuances is essential for mastering English in Hong Kong. The way language is used can vary significantly based on cultural context. For instance, the use of idioms, slang, and formal versus informal language can differ greatly. Engaging with local communities and participating in cultural events can provide valuable insights into these nuances, making your language skills more effective and contextually appropriate.
Additionally, being aware of the local dialects and variations of English spoken in Hong Kong, such as “Hong Kong English,” can enhance your communication skills. This dialect incorporates elements of Cantonese and reflects the unique cultural identity of the city.
